About This Book
Discover the journey of a determined immigrant who transformed a humble peddler's life into a global denim empire. Follow the inspiring story of hard work, innovation, and the birth of the iconic blue jeans that changed fashion forever. Perfect for young readers curious about history and entrepreneurship.

Why we rated Mr. Blue Jeans 11C
Mr. Blue Jeans is written at a Level 6-7 reading level across 64 pages (approximately 8,305 words). Strong independent readers around grade 7.2 can typically handle this book on their own; with parent or teacher support, Mr. Blue Jeans works for readers up to grade 8.2.
Read aloud, Mr. Blue Jeans takes about 55 minutes, which fits within a single read-aloud session.
We rate Mr. Blue Jeans as 11C ("Clear") because the content sits in the "Gentle" range — no conflict beyond everyday childhood experiences. Across our four dimensions (emotional, physical, social, thematic) the book reads as evenly gentle; no single dimension stands out as a concern.
No specific content flags were raised by community reviewers, which is consistent with the gentle intensity score.
Thematically, Mr. Blue Jeans explores biography, history, businesspeople, and coming of age — these threads give the book room to mean different things to different readers.
